This may sound like a simple practice more question, but how do you read bunches of jumbled up notes? Like in Horizon Remix? Thanks.
|
06-8-2011, 05:25 PM | #273 |
soleil ardent
Join Date: May 2007
Location: New York
Age: 27
Posts: 6,513
|
Re: Frequently Asked Questions [FAQ]
The best way would be to raise your speed mod (Found in Settings). It takes a lot of getting used to, because the arrows come faster depending on how much you alter it (I suggest moving up by around .5-1.0 each time you get comfortable, until you reach a perfect, desirable speed for you. I personally play at 1.5X.). When you first play with a new Speed mod, your skill will most likely drop a little at first, but after you get used to seeing the arrows, your skill will return to normal, and most likely get better.

Thanks. But my reading skill sucks and I'm already playing 1.9, lol. Does anyone play at 2.5? That's probably the speed I'll be playing at by the time I'm done raising it.
|
06-10-2011, 04:31 PM | #275 |
Fractals!
|
Re: Frequently Asked Questions [FAQ]
In that case, try lowering your speed mod (1.9 is considered high by most players). High speed mods are notorious for making individual arrows hard to pick out (in the old days of speed mods, when you had to pick from a list, 3x was only used as a joke).
Your eyes and fingers still need time to pick out individual notes and how they join together in the patterns you're having trouble with. 1.75 is the speed most of the best players use, with a variation of about 0.1 depending on their strengths, but in the end it's really about finding a speed you're comfortable with. |
